Manufacturing Safety Engineer (Temporary)
Ensign-Bickford Aerospace & Defense Company (EBAD) is seeking a Manufacturing Safety Engineer for a temporary assignment to support production operations in a highly regulated manufacturing environment. This role is responsible for ensuring that manufacturing processes are designed and executed safely, leading safety reviews, and collaborating with various teams to mitigate risks and ensure compliance.

Responsibilities
Review manufacturing processes, equipment, and tooling to identify safety and ergonomic risks and drive mitigation actions
Lead Process Hazard Analyses (PHA), including HAZOPs, JHAs, PFMEAs, and other structured risk assessments for new and existing processes
Own and drive safety-related action items from hazard analyses, incidents, and audits through verification and closeout
Ensure all manufacturing processes—with emphasis on powder and energetic/hazardous material processes—are designed and operated safely and in compliance with applicable regulations
Develop, review, and maintain manufacturing documentation including process specifications, work instructions, and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) with embedded safety requirements
Partner with Manufacturing Engineering, Quality, and Production to integrate safety controls into process design, tooling, layouts, and standard work
Support incident, near-miss, and safety event investigations, including root cause analysis and corrective/preventive actions (RCCA)
Conduct ergonomic assessments and implement improvements to reduce strain, repetitive motion injuries, and operator risk
Support management of change (MOC) activities to ensure safety risks are evaluated prior to process or equipment changes
Participate in audits and inspections related to OSHA, internal EHS standards, and customer or regulatory requirements
Provide safety guidance and training to engineering and operations teams as needed
Track safety metrics, risks, and mitigation status and communicate progress to stakeholders
